MIG Operator

Controls

MIG/CNTL

LOCL

LOCL - REMT

LOCL = Local control of the Wirespeed

and Voltage with the machines controls.

REMT = Remote control of the Wirespeed and

Voltage with an accessory device.

Pre Flow (MIG

Setting)

PRE-/FLOW

0.1 S

0.0 – 5 S

Shielding gas flows for the time specified before

an arc is initiated.

Run In

RUN/IN

70%

30 – 150 % Wirespeed runs as a percentage of preview wire-

speed until an arc is struck.

Post Flow (MIG

Setting)

POST/FLOW

0.5 S

0.0 – 30 S

Shielding gas flows for the time specified after

an arc has extinguished.

Burn Back

BURN/BACK

0.15 S

0.00 – 1.00 S The time difference between turning the wire feed

OFF before the voltage is turned OFF.

Wire Sharp

WIRE/SHRP

ON

OFF – ON

Wire Sharp adds a burst of current at the end of

a weld to remove the ball at the end of the wire.

This improves the restart of the next weld.

Spot

SPOT

OFF

OFF – ON

Spot is used to weld two thin plates together at

a desired location by melting the top & bottom

plates together to form a nugget between them.

The weld time is set by the Spot Time.

Spot Time
(Only shown/

e n a b l e d i f

Spot=ON)

SPOT/TIME

2.0 S

0.1 – 20.0 S Spot Time is the time used for the Spot weld

mode.

Stitch

STCH

OFF

OFF – ON

Stitch is used to weld two or more components

by stitch or interval weld together.

The weld time is set by the Stitch Time and the

non weld time is set by the Dwell Time.

Stitch Time
(Only shown/

e n a b l e d i f

Stitch=ON)

STCH/TIME

2.0 S

0.2 – 4.0 S

Stitch Time is the time used for the weld time in

Stitch weld mode.

Dwell Time
(Only shown/

e n a b l e d i f

Stitch=ON)

DWEL/TIME

0.5 S

0.1 – 1.0 S

Dwell Time is the time used for the non weld time

in Stitch weld mode.

Arc Type

ARC-/TYPE

AUTO

AUTO – CV-M

Auto is an optimized arc control for dip transfer

welding with minimal spatter on mild steel with

mixed shielding gases. CV-M is the traditional

constant-voltage arc control for all other welding.

Wire Feed Speed

Units

WFS/UNIT

MPM

MPM – IPM

MPM provides preview wirespeed in Metres

Per Minute.

IPM provides preview wirespeed in Inches Per

Minute.
